Transaction 3437875006062feb6bf54b75fb08742838c2aea50e2de45329d1fa8d240e75b9

1 Input
2 Outputs
  • 3437875006062feb6bf54b75fb08742838c2aea50e2de45329d1fa8d240e75b9:0
  • value  1618500
    address  1DqrA2RXQB4dmPN4KMni16YPrFSsXvoKvq
  • 3437875006062feb6bf54b75fb08742838c2aea50e2de45329d1fa8d240e75b9:1
  • value  1570048
    address  1JviqKUPbxG2puaJPDczr5axWKt8QN9KrE